
Inconel 625 Turbine wheel
Density: 8.28 g/cm3
Melting point: 1295-1381℃
Magnetic: no
Linear expansion coefficient: 12.1-16.1 Hardness: 150-220 (HB)
Inconel 625 is a nickel-based alloy that is commonly used in the construction of turbine components due to its excellent combination of high-temperature strength, corrosion resistance, and overall mechanical properties. Here's an introduction to Inconel 625 turbines:
UNS N06625/W.NR.2.4856/alloy625
It has excellent corrosion resistance and oxidation resistance, has good tensile properties and fatigue properties from low temperature to 980 °C, and is resistant to stress corrosion in salt spray atmosphere. Therefore, it can be widely used in the manufacture of aero-engine parts, aerospace structural parts and chemical equipment and occasions exposed to seawater and subjected to high mechanical stress.
Similar Grades
United States: UNS N06625
France: NC 22DNb
United Kingdom: NA21
Germany: W.Nr.2.4856, NiCr22Mo9Nb
Technical Standard
ASTM B446, ASTM B564
ASM 5666
